Küme Seçenekleri

public class ClusterOptions
extends Object implements IClusterOptions

Java.lang.Nesne
🎃 com.android.tradefed.cluster.ClusterOptions


Özet

Fields'ın oynadığı filmler

public static final String TYPE_NAME

Benzersiz yapılandırma nesnesi türü adı.

public String mClusterId

public mNextClusterIds

public String mServiceUrl

Kamu inşaatçıları

ClusterOptions()

Herkese açık yöntemler

boolean checkCommandState()

Komut durumunun (TF kümesinde) sinyal sırasında kontrol edilip edilmeyeceği.

boolean checkPermitsOnLease()

Kiralamadan önce mevcut izinleri kontrol edin.

String getClusterId()

Bu TF örneği için küme kimliğini alın.

int getConnectTimeout()

http bağlantı zaman aşımı alın.

MultiMap<String, String> getDeviceGroup()

Cihaz grubunu cihaz eşlemeyle eşleştirin.

long getDeviceMonitorSnapshotInterval()

Cihaz anlık görüntüleri arasındaki zaman aralığını ms olarak alın.

getDeviceTag()

Etiket eşleme için cihazın seri bilgilerini alın.

long getInvocationHeartbeatInterval()

Çağrı kalp atışları arasındaki zaman aralığını ms olarak öğrenin.

String getLabName()

Ana makinenin ait olduğu laboratuvarın adını alın.

getLabels()

Ana makine için etiketleri alın.

getNextClusterIds()

Bu TF örneği için ikincil küme kimliklerini alın.

int getReadTimeout()

http okuma zaman aşımı alın.

String getRunTargetFormat()

Çalıştırma hedeflerini etiketlemeye yönelik biçimi alın.

File getSchedulerServiceAccountKeyfile()

Takas edilen test planlayıcı hizmet hesabı anahtar dosyasını alın.

String getSchedulerServiceUrl()

Takas edilen test planlayıcı hizmeti URL'sini alın.

String getServiceUrl()

Takas edilen küme REST API'nin temel URL'sini alın.

boolean isDeviceMonitorDisabled()

Küme cihaz raporlamasının devre dışı olup olmadığını döndürür.

long maxDiskUsagePercentage()

Ek yeni görevlerin kiralamasını durdurmadan önce maksimum disk kullanım yüzdesi.

boolean shouldCollectEarlyTestSummary()

Planlayıcının erken test özetini toplaması gerekip gerekmediğini döndürür.

Boolean shouldUploadInvocationStatus()

TF'nin çağrı durumunu yükleyip yüklemeyeceğini döndürür.

Fields'ın oynadığı filmler

TÜR_ADI

public static final String TYPE_NAME

Benzersiz yapılandırma nesnesi türü adı. Şuradan tekil örneği almak için kullanılır: GlobalConfiguration

Şu kaynakları da inceleyin:

Mobil Küme Kimliği

public String mClusterId

mSonrakiKüme Kimlikleri

public  mNextClusterIds

Mobil Hizmet URL'si

public String mServiceUrl

Kamu inşaatçıları

Küme Seçenekleri

public ClusterOptions ()

Herkese açık yöntemler

checkCommandState

public boolean checkCommandState ()

Komut durumunun (TF kümesinde) sinyal sırasında kontrol edilip edilmeyeceği.

İlerlemeler
boolean

checkPermitsOnLease

public boolean checkPermitsOnLease ()

Kiralamadan önce mevcut izinleri kontrol edin.

İlerlemeler
boolean

getClusterId

public String getClusterId ()

Bu TF örneği için küme kimliğini alın.

İlerlemeler
String

getConnectZaman Aşımı

public int getConnectTimeout ()

http bağlantı zaman aşımı alın.

İlerlemeler
int

getDeviceGroup

public MultiMap<String, String> getDeviceGroup ()

Cihaz grubunu cihaz eşlemeyle eşleştirin.

İlerlemeler
MultiMap<String, String>

getDeviceMonitorSnapshotInterval

public long getDeviceMonitorSnapshotInterval ()

Cihaz anlık görüntüleri arasındaki zaman aralığını ms olarak alın.

İlerlemeler
long

getDeviceTag

public  getDeviceTag ()

Etiket eşleme için cihazın seri bilgilerini alın.

İlerlemeler

getInvocationHeartbeatInterval

public long getInvocationHeartbeatInterval ()

Çağrı kalp atışları arasındaki zaman aralığını ms olarak öğrenin.

İlerlemeler
long

getLabName

public String getLabName ()

Ana makinenin ait olduğu laboratuvarın adını alın.

İlerlemeler
String

getEtiketler

public  getLabels ()

Ana makine için etiketleri alın.

İlerlemeler

getNextClusterId'ler

public  getNextClusterIds ()

Bu TF örneği için ikincil küme kimliklerini alın.

İlerlemeler

getReadZaman Aşımı

public int getReadTimeout ()

http okuma zaman aşımı alın.

İlerlemeler
int

getRunTargetFormat

public String getRunTargetFormat ()

Çalıştırma hedeflerini etiketlemeye yönelik biçimi alın.

İlerlemeler
String

getSchedulerServiceAccountKeyfile

public File getSchedulerServiceAccountKeyfile ()

Takas edilen test planlayıcı hizmet hesabı anahtar dosyasını alın.

İlerlemeler
File

getSchedulerServiceUrl'si

public String getSchedulerServiceUrl ()

Takas edilen test planlayıcı hizmeti URL'sini alın.

İlerlemeler
String

getServiceUrl

public String getServiceUrl ()

Takas edilen küme REST API'nin temel URL'sini alın.

İlerlemeler
String

isDeviceMonitorDisabled

public boolean isDeviceMonitorDisabled ()

Küme cihaz raporlamasının devre dışı olup olmadığını döndürür.

İlerlemeler
boolean

maxDiskUsagePercentage

public long maxDiskUsagePercentage ()

Ek yeni görevlerin kiralamasını durdurmadan önce maksimum disk kullanım yüzdesi.

İlerlemeler
long

shouldCollectErkenTestÖzeti

public boolean shouldCollectEarlyTestSummary ()

Planlayıcının erken test özetini toplaması gerekip gerekmediğini döndürür.

İlerlemeler
boolean

gerekenUploadInvocationStatus

public Boolean shouldUploadInvocationStatus ()

TF'nin çağrı durumunu yükleyip yüklemeyeceğini döndürür.

İlerlemeler
Boolean